Bonhams to Auction Sandy Lerner's Cat Art and Ayrshire Farm Treasures

market-auction · 2026-08-18

This fall, Bonhams will showcase The Sandy Lerner Collection, a four-part auction series featuring nearly 1,000 items from the estate of Sandy Lerner (b. 1955), an American entrepreneur and philanthropist. The collection is renowned for being one of the most important private assemblages of cat-themed decorative arts, books, and collectibles, as well as historic furnishings. The auctions are scheduled for September and October in New York and Massachusetts, comprising two live events and two online sessions. Lerner, a trailblazing technologist and co-founder of Cisco Systems, has established a career marked by creativity and intellectual depth. The sale embodies years of careful collection and showcases centuries of artistic achievement.
